xAPI, exports and APIs: why lineage matters more than the connection method

Teams argue about which integration method is best. The more important question is whether you can trace every number back to where it came from.

xAPI, exports and APIs: why lineage matters more than the connection method

The methods

File exports are universal and often the only option for legacy systems. APIs give structured, repeatable access but rarely expose everything. Direct database connections reach the most but require trust and care. xAPI streams capture granular activity from content. SFTP and cloud storage suit scheduled batch transfers. Each method has a place; most real integrations use several.

What gets lost in translation

A completion date stored as text in one system and a timestamp in another. A score on a 0 to 100 scale beside one on 0 to 10. An enrolment status that means "completed" in one platform and "passed" in another. Normalization makes these comparable, but the original value must survive alongside the clean one or the transformation cannot be verified.

Lineage defined

For each record: the source system, connector and extraction run; the original identifier and field values; every mapping and transformation applied, with its version; identity match decisions that touched the record; and who approved its promotion into the governed layer.

Why it earns its keep

Auditors ask where a number came from. Migration teams must prove nothing changed in transit. BI teams need to know which source a field reflects. Lineage answers all three from the same place. It is not overhead; it is the thing that makes the rest trustworthy.

A note on xAPI

xAPI statements are rich but not self-governing. A learning record store full of statements still needs identity reconciliation, normalization and lineage to be useful for reporting or audits. Treat it as another source, not as the answer.
